在结构设计当中,使用钢管混凝土结构的时间不是很长,但是使用的范围很广泛。尤其是近些年钢管混凝土叠合柱的使用颇为流行。钢管混凝土叠合柱结构是一种复合结构,相较于一般的钢筋混凝土结构有更强的承载能力,同时也具有更加优越的抗震效能,在一些地震频发地区和需要较大承载力的结构中需要使用到钢管混凝土叠合柱。在本文中,我们就详细的介绍了钢管混凝土叠合柱的使用原理,尤其是对于该结构的抗震性能和使用的经济效益进行说明,并总结出钢管混凝土叠合柱结构在使用中的不足之处,以便在以后的施工工程中更好的发挥材料的特性。
In the structural design, the use of concrete-filled steel tube structure of the time is not very long, but the use of a wide range. In particular, the use of CFST columns in recent years is quite popular. The CFST column structure is a kind of composite structure, which has stronger bearing capacity than the common reinforced concrete structure and also has more superior seismic performance. In some areas with frequent earthquakes and structures that require large bearing capacity Need to use to the concrete filled steel tubular column. In this paper, we introduce the use principle of CFST columns in detail, especially for the seismic performance of the structure and the economic benefits of using, and summarize the shortcomings in the use of the concrete filled steel tubular column structure Department, so that in the future construction projects to better play the characteristics of the material.
